1,500 Tons of Garbage Transported from TB Simatupang Ciliwung Garbage Filter

The heavy rainfall on the upstream area made the water level of Katulampa, Bogor, West Jakarta reached level 1 on Sunday (3/2) night.

The Orange Taskforce of Jakarta Environmental Agency remain struggle to keep the river body from the garbage piles after the heavy rain.

Personnel and heavy equipment are deployed at Ciliwung Garbage Filter in TB Simatupang, South Jakarta, since Sunday (3/2) at 10 PM.

As the result, there are 1,500 tons of garbage transported from the filter up to Monday (3/3) morning.

Jakarta Environmental Agency Head, Asep Kuswanto explained the cleaning is still run to prevent dam effect that can impede water flow.

"The handle remains run to avoid dam effect that disturbs the water flow," Asep said, Monday (3/3).

He added that 60 personnel are involved during the operation including seven heavy equipment such as amphibious excavator, material handler, and wheel loader.
